【Http认证方式】——Basic认证
访问时,浏览器弹出窗口需要输入用户名和密码。
在浏览器中,可以在url中加入用户名和密码进行访问,格式如下:
http://用户名:密码@127.0.0.1:8000/API/User/1
但这仅仅在浏览器中才行,因为浏览器帮我们做了一些处理。
其真正格式为:
原来是放在了HttpHeader中:
key为 "Authorization",
value为 "Basic " + "用户名:密码"进行base64编码
特别注意: Basic后面有一个空格。